A Vanuatu Community Group! I'm currently looking for any EOI, funding, fisheries cold chain equipment, training or other support for the following, know of any suitable organisation/grant/training/other opportunity given , commitment to responsible sourced fisheries, social and community initiatives and interlinkages to Vanuatu business/ sustainable fisheries/community initiatives for the remote Vanuatu Island community for my former student Fishing is at the heart of our culture, economy, and daily survival amid global climate change, pollution, IUU fisheries and other emerging threats. For the past two years, our community has struggled because the only ice box freezer unit we had stopped working, cutting off our ability to preserve fish and supply locally and urban markets. We are now seeking your help to restore and rebuild this critical system, not just a single freezer but a comprehensive cold chain management system that will ensure fresh fish can be safely stored, transported, and sold. Bringing income and food security to our people once again. Why Do We Need Your Support This contributes to responsible, sustainably sourced traceable fishing, reducing the need for dangerous trips, improving nutrition and food security, climate resilience and livelihoods, given high fuel, transport and safety costs from multiple voyages and fisheries spoilage on reefs. It aids women fish processors selling in the market, youth and our actual fisherfolk. Fishing is one of the few reliable ways our community can earn a living. But without cold storage, we: Can't store fish for more than a few hours Lose most of our catch to spoilage Can't sell in urban markets like Santo and Port Vila Rely heavily on short-term, daily consumption with no pack up We were once supported with a freezer unit on each Island in our group of Islands, but it stopped operating two years ago and has not been repaired due to a lack of funds, logistics, and technical assistance.
